Harry Styles was the big winner at the BRIT awards, Britain’s pop music honors, on Saturday, February 11, winning all four categories he had been nominated in, a week after his triumph at the Grammys.

LONDON, United Kingdom – , song of the year for his synth pop hit “As It Was”, best pop/R&B act and artist of the year, one of two gender-neutral categories introduced last year after BRIT awards organizers got rid of female and male distinctions.

“I’m really, really grateful for this and I’m very aware of my privilege up here tonight,” Styles said in his acceptance speech, dedicating the artist of the year award to a list of female singers.as a member of boy band One Direction, last week won two Grammy awards, including album of the year. A statement on the BRIT Awards’ website said the gender-neutral categories had been introduced so artists were judged “solely on the quality and popularity of their work, rather than on who they are, or how they choose to identify.”

“Of the 71 eligible artists on the longlist, only 12 are women. We recognise this points to wider issues around the representation of women in music that must also be addressed.”
